抗耐药菌抗生素的研究进展

Research Progress in Antibiotics against Resistant Bacteria

  • 摘要: 抗生素是20世纪最重要的发现之一,抗生素的存在大大降低了由常规手术带来的术后感染的威胁。然而,抗生素的滥用和乱用,使得耐药菌的种类和数量越来越多,由此造成的复杂性、难治型细菌感染给临床治疗带来了巨大的威胁,因此,临床迫切需要新型抗耐药菌抗生素来应对这一难题。简要概述了唑烷酮类、四环素、糖肽类等近几年在研的几类抗耐药菌抗生素结构及研究进展情况,以期为后续研发提供参考。

     

    Abstract: Antibiotics are one of the most important discoveries of the 20th century. The presence of antibiotics has significantly reduced the risk of postoperative infection after conventional surgery. However, the abuse and misuse of antibiotics have led to increased species and quantity of resistant bacteria, leading to the rise of complex and refractory infection and imposing great challenges to clinical treatment. Therefore, there is an urgent need of new antibiotics against resistant bacteria to deal with this problem. This paper briefly overviewed the structures and research progress of several types of antibiotics against resistant bacteria that are under investigation in recent years, including oxazolidinones, tetracycline and glycopeptides, so as to provide reference for subsequent research and development
